What is a warranty letter?
Warranty letters are most commonly required by carriers when an applicant is purchasing a particular type of coverage for the first time and when an insured buys higher limits. The requirement also varies by the type of coverage.

Can I give my warranty to someone else?
With a transferable warranty, that warranty stays in effect even if the product changes owners. For a home roof, this means that, if you sell your home before the warranty on a new roof expires, then the new owner is protected by that same warranty.

How do I transfer my warranty to another person?
In most cases, to transfer a car warranty to a new owner, the current owner of the vehicle will contact the warranty company or dealership to initiate the transfer process or send a letter to let the warranty provider know about the sale of the car. This usually has to be done within 30 days.

What does it mean when a warranty is not transferable?
A non transferable warranty isn't bad, it's the same warranty coverage as a transferable warranty. The only difference is that it stays with the original purchaser and cannot transfer to another owner. Each manufacturer and product is unique and has varying performance levels requiring different warranty coverage.

Do product warranties transfer to new owners?
Do Warranties Transfer to New Owners? In nearly every case, factory new car warranties are tied to the vehicle identification number (VIN). Therefore, the new car warranty will be valid for the entire warranty term regardless of ownership.

What is transferable warranty?
Transfer warranty refers to an implied promise relating to the title and credibility of an instrument made by a transferor to a transferee. Generally, a transfer warranty is made for transfers through indorsement. A transfer warranty can also be granted to any remote transferee through indorsement of an instrument.

Can a warranty be transferred UK?
' You may be selling a car that has a warranty in place, or you may be looking to buy a vehicle that has cover arranged by its current owner. Either way, the warranty will normally transfer with the car, so the buyer will gain the benefit of having the warranty for the rest of its term.

Can a product warranty be transferred?
Federal law requires that written warranties that come with products costing more than $10 be labeled "full" or "limited." Full warranties are transferable, don't limit implied warranties or require the consumer to pay any fees to obtain service (such as shipping charges), and give customers the option of a replacement ...
